First up, China Glaze - Anchors Away

Sail away this spring in 12 nautically-inspired colors from China Glaze. These bold and confident brights are reminiscent of a carefree natural getaway, with soft ethereal hues that inspire leisurely thoughts of sand and sea. Colors in this collection include:

· Life Preserver: Highly pigmented and luxurious poppy crème.
· Hey Sailor: Vibrant crème red.
· Ahoy!: Delightfully intense pink that flashes with reflective glass speck.
· First Mate: Sophisticated and rich navy crème.
· Starboard: Hip and playful green crème.
· Lighthouse: Multi-dimensional, bright yellow glass speck.
· White Cap: Whimsical and sparkling multi-dimensional white.
· Pelican Gray: High shine, cool toned grey crème.
· Sea Spray: Calming pale blue crème.
· Below Deck: A flirty mix of taupe and violet.
· Sunset Sail: Delightful peachy pink high shine crème.
· Knotty: Micro-particle beige shimmer.

Color Club also has just released the information about their Alter Ego collection for Spring

Color Club lets you create high-fashion looks for every identity with Alter Ego, their latest collection of diverse, long-lasting lacquers!

Alter Ego’s consists of 12 shades! Go incognito with our opaque shades or rendezvous in full view with our sheers of Alter Ego ‘LIGHTS’ and ‘DARKS’!

Alter Ego’s ‘Reveal Your Mystery Collection’ 7 piece salon pack includes Get a Clue, Revealed, Incognito, Secret Rendezvous, Sheer Disguise, and Give Me a Hint shades plus Milky White Base Coat. Their ‘Keep It Undercover Collection’ 7 piece salon pack includes Alter Ego, Secret Agent, Total Mystery, Alias, Ulterior Motive and Masquerading plus Vivid Top Coat.
